meta-digi-arm: u-boot: fix trustfence checks logic
There are several possible values for TRUSTFENCE_UBOOT_ENV_DEK:
* Not defined: if the trustfence support is not included.
Should not include the feature.
* 32 characters: when defining a valid key.
Should include the feature.
* "0": when explicetily disabling the feature.
Should not include the feature
* <other>: Invalid value, should trigger the error.
This commits fixes the logic so that 'None' (no defined) is taken as a valid
value.
